Very nice Jack.
2nd one down could be George French.
3rd one down 'Bayou Belle' - (FRE 1982 Cream with pink edge. Green throat, red base. Outer cream-pink. Overlapping funnel form. {XL} 'Flirtation' x 'Pink Jeroma'. Reg. #09904).
Both by the maestro hybridizer George French.
